What are some alternatives?

When comparing DXR and GitHub Polls, you can also consider the following products

Sourcegraph - Sourcegraph is a free, self-hosted code search and intelligence server that helps developers find, review, understand, and debug code. Use it with any Git code host for teams from 1 to 10,000+.

Twitter Polls - Polls embedded in tweets

OpenGrok - OpenGrok is a fast and usable source code search and cross reference engine.

LXR - LXR Cross Referencer, usually known as LXR, is a general-purpose source code indexer and cross-referencer that provides web-based browsing of source code, with links to the definition and usage of any identifier
